Congress has returned from its August recess with significant unfinished business, including the critical task of passing appropriations bills to avert a government shutdown. Lawmakers face a limited window before the fiscal year ends on September 30, with government funding again at risk. Failure to agree on a temporary spending resolution could lead to a shutdown, impacting federal operations, including farm loans, conservation payments, and research programs.
